Longtime alum Roger Ross Williams’ new documentary tells the rich history of the Apollo Theater in Harlem – The Apollo is available to stream for free in April on HBO. “It’s 85 years of the history of black music and black entertainment in this country. We used music and art to lift ourselves out of oppression.” - Roger Ross WilliamsWilliams received a 2011 Sundance Documentary Fund Grant for his first feature length documentary God Loves Uganda, attended the Documentary Edit and Story Lab with the film in 2012, and premiered it during the 2013 Sundance Film Festival. Life, Animated, Roger Ross Williams’ second feature documentary, premiered at the 2016 Festival and won the Directing Award: U.S. Documentary.Most recently Roger Ross Williams attended the 2019 Sundance Film Festival with Traveling While Black, an installation and VR experience at New Frontier.Stream The Apollo on HBO and check out the trailer below:Photo of Roger Ross Williams during the Sundance Film Festival premiere of Life, Animated. © 2016 Sundance Institute | Photo by Jonathan Hickerson -- source link
